WebJan 19, 2024 · Nonviral gene therapy can be used safely and practically to treat DPN. ... most investigations have been at the nonclinical level. VM202 (Engensis), a nonviral plasmid DNA product, is the first gene medicine to enter advanced clinical trials for treatment of painful DPN.
